Hi.

A few days ago I try a consumption report bandwidth but my device showed me a error telling me not find a specific column in the database.

 

Looking at the forum found that I could be a problem of the database where the update firmware, did not properly update the structure of the database. So attempt a reconstruction of the database, but it turns out after executing the procedure, the equipment does not work properly.

 

 

I guess do something wrong during the procedure execution. Now I require is completely format the disk and load the firmware and make a new database. The data that the device currently do not mind losing them as they are replicated on another server.

I searched for information on this procedure but can not find any serious procedure. Could anyone help?

 

Thank you

    Now I require is completely format the disk and load the firmware and make a new database.

     using below steps

     

    1. upgrade to latest release like FAZ 5.2.4 0738

    2. on FAZ GUI - System Settings - Dashboard - System Information widget, backup "System Configuration"

    3. exec reset all-settings

    4. exec format disk

    5. re-config IP

    6. you can restore config from 2, or you can just re-add device into Device Manager and re-config other config like report etc on FAZ

     

    but normally, FAZ just need to rebuild SQL db "exe sql-local rebuild-db" and if this still not working, and your 1st pic is in collector mode, can you provide more details for "try a consumption report bandwidth but my device showed me a error telling me not find a specific column in the database.", so how you generate a report and what error you see from where?

     

    also, is it for a predefined report or a user created report? what FGT version send logs to FAZ?
